Usability vs. Feature Bloat. Have Rapidweaver Themes Gotten Too Complicated? More Doesn't Always Mean Better.

rwthemeicon200
We've taken a break and been quiet this year regarding Rapidweaver theme development and the Realmac forum here at Blueball Design, but we've been keeping an eye on a trend that started appearing the past year for Rapidweaver themes: The reliance on javascript gimmicks and the huge unnecessary amounts of theme variations added into themes to help market them.

This has made the use of Rapidweaver themes in general much more difficult for the average to new Rapidweaver users then it should be. For advanced users who have the knowledge to fine tune and adjust the code to get it to work like they want for their sites it's not been a problem. But we've seen more and more support questions and posts about problems with these types of themes in the Realmac support forums.

So a couple of observations and comments on Rapidweaver themes:

1. There's a reason the stock Rapidweaver themes are kept simple. They just work with minimal effort required. The only thing they really need added to them are some custom image slots.
2. More is not better especially where web sites are concerned. The more javascripts you use on a site page, the greater the chance your pages will not load correctly, especially in IE6 and IE7. Also the chance for a conflict happening with a third party page plugin or stack is much greater.
3. There's a limit to the number of css files that IE6, IE7, and IE8 can apply to a site page. Currently these browsers can only apply up to a maximum number of 31 css files to a single site page. So if the theme you are using has more than 31 theme variations, any css file past the 31st css file listed in your web page will not be applied to style your page.
4. With web sites the simplest solution is always the best one. If someone goes to your web site and has to wait for the page to load, guess what? They go somewhere else. If someone goes to your web site and focuses on how nice the layout looks before seeing your site content and images, how effective is that theme layout? The viewer's focus should always go to your site content and images first before anything else. If the theme layout overwhelms your content instead of enhancing the content, you may want to review how effective your site is and if the layout used is acheiving your current goals.

This is not meant to detract from other theme developer's efforts as many outstanding themes have come out, but rather just some observations from us on the current state of Rapidweaver theme development, and that MAYBE an effort should be started to bring back simpler and easier to use Rapidweaver themes for the average and new Rapidweaver users. The Rapidweaver Plugins We Use Everyday Here For Rapidweaver Sites We Create For Clients.

pluginicon
Everyone has their favorite Rapidweaver plugins they like to use for their Rapidweaver sites but I thought I'd mention the ones we like and use. We've found ourselves using just a few day in and day out on sites we develop for clients here, and have come to rely on them probably more than we should. Here they are in no particular order:

Stacks

If you are going to buy any plugin make it this one! Without a doubt the most versatile plugin we've ever used, Stacks in our opinion is the best plugin Isaiah at www.yourhead.com has ever developed. We use it on every Rapidweaver site we develop now. It's simple to use, very flexible, and just works. This is what all Rapidweaver plugins should be like.

RapidSearch

The easiest and preferred way to add search functionality to your Rapidweaver site and amazingly simple to use. www.joshlockhart.com's RapidSearch plugin has evolved into one of our most used plugins and one we can't do without! We use it on every Rapidweaver site we develop and it works perfectly every time.

PlusKit

More powerful than it first appears, this highly useful multi-faceted plugin from www.loghound.com allows you to place sites pages within site pages, add another page into a block or stack, and much, much more. Not as easy to setup and use the first time but the more you use Pluskit, the more you'll rely on it. We use it now on every site we develop.

RapidBlog

If you're like us, a lot of our clients we create Rapidweaver sites for are stuck using PCs at work but want to be able to edit or add to their blog page from their PC. With www.loghound.com's RapidBlog plugin, they can easily do this from any location using a PC or a Mac. We recommend this alternative blog page plugin over Rapidweaver's default blog page plugin, and use it on every site we create for clients.

SiteMap

This feature should have been built into Rapidweaver as a default page style, but thanks to John at www.loghound.com and his SiteMap plugin, you can knock out a complete site map of your Rapidweaver site with a couple of clicks.
